Escolher uma graduação na área de tecnologia pode parecer simples no início, mas rapidamente surgem dúvidas importantes.
Afinal, Computer Engineering e Ciência da Computação são cursos parecidos? O mercado valoriza mais um do que o outro? Qual oferece melhores salários e oportunidades?
Com a transformação digital acelerando em praticamente todos os setores, a demanda por profissionais qualificados em tecnologia cresce ano após ano.
Segundo dados de consultorias internacionais, a escassez de talentos em TI já impacta diretamente a inovação e a competitividade das empresas. Isso torna a escolha da formação ainda mais estratégica para quem deseja construir uma carreira sólida.
In this article from ESEG Blog, você vai entender as principais diferenças entre esses dois cursos, como funciona o mercado de trabalho para cada área, quais habilidades são mais valorizadas e como tomar uma decisão alinhada aos seus objetivos profissionais.
Continue lendo para descobrir qual caminho pode fazer mais sentido para o seu futuro.
O que é Engenharia da Computação e qual é o foco dessa formação?
A Computer Engineering é um curso voltado para o desenvolvimento e integração entre hardware e software. Ou seja, o profissional aprende tanto a projetar sistemas computacionais físicos quanto a programar soluções tecnológicas que interagem diretamente com equipamentos e dispositivos.
Durante a graduação, você terá contato com disciplinas como eletrônica, arquitetura de computadores, sistemas embarcados, redes, inteligência artificial, automação e programação. Isso significa que o engenheiro da computação possui uma visão mais ampla do funcionamento completo das tecnologias digitais.
Na prática, essa formação prepara você para trabalhar em áreas como automação industrial, internet das coisas (IoT), robótica, telecomunicações e desenvolvimento de hardware. É uma escolha interessante para quem gosta de entender como as coisas funcionam “por dentro” e deseja atuar em projetos tecnológicos complexos.
O que é Ciência da Computação e quais são suas principais aplicações?
Already computer Science tem um foco mais direcionado ao desenvolvimento de software, algoritmos e soluções digitais baseadas em lógica computacional. Aqui, o objetivo principal é criar sistemas inteligentes, aplicativos, plataformas e tecnologias baseadas em dados.
Ao longo do curso, você vai estudar estruturas de dados, engenharia de software, banco de dados, machine learning, segurança da informação e computação em nuvem. É uma formação extremamente estratégica em um mundo cada vez mais orientado por tecnologia e inovação.
Profissionais formados nessa área costumam atuar como desenvolvedores, cientistas de dados, arquitetos de software, especialistas em inteligência artificial ou líderes de projetos tecnológicos. Se você gosta de programação, análise lógica e resolução de problemas complexos, essa pode ser a escolha ideal.
Diferenças entre os cursos
Embora as graduações compartilhem algumas disciplinas básicas, existem diferenças importantes que impactam diretamente o perfil profissional e as oportunidades no mercado de trabalho.
A Computer Engineering combina conhecimentos técnicos de Engenharia com programação, o que possibilita atuar tanto na criação de sistemas físicos quanto digitais. Já a ciência da computação aprofunda conceitos matemáticos e computacionais voltados à criação de soluções digitais escaláveis.
Outra diferença relevante está na abordagem prática. Engenheiros costumam trabalhar mais próximos de projetos industriais, equipamentos e infraestrutura tecnológica.
Cientistas da computação, por sua vez, estão mais presentes em empresas de tecnologia, startups, fintechs e organizações que lidam com grandes volumes de dados.
Como está o mercado de trabalho para essas áreas?
O mercado para profissionais de tecnologia está aquecido e com tendência de crescimento contínuo. Relatórios do setor indicam que a digitalização das empresas deve gerar milhões de novas vagas relacionadas à computação nos próximos anos.
In Computer Engineering, há forte demanda em setores como indústria 4.0, automação, telecomunicações e desenvolvimento de dispositivos inteligentes. Empresas que investem em inovação tecnológica buscam profissionais capazes de integrar software e hardware de forma eficiente.
Na ciência da computação, o crescimento é ainda mais acelerado em áreas como desenvolvimento de software, inteligência artificial, automação, análise de dados e segurança digital.
Grandes empresas de tecnologia, bancos digitais e startups competem por talentos capazes de criar soluções inovadoras e escaláveis.
Read also: 15 áreas para trabalhar com tecnologia
Salários e perspectivas de crescimento na carreira
Muitos estudantes que estão interessados na área se perguntam: quanto ganha um engenheiro da computação ou um cientista em computação? Os salários nas duas áreas são considerados atrativos e tendem a aumentar conforme a experiência e a especialização do profissional.
No início da carreira, tanto engenheiros quanto cientistas da computação podem encontrar oportunidades com remuneração competitiva em relação a outras áreas.
Com o tempo, cargos como líder técnico, arquiteto de sistemas, gerente de tecnologia ou especialista em inteligência artificial podem proporcionar ganhos significativamente maiores. Além disso, a possibilidade de atuar remotamente para empresas internacionais amplia ainda mais o potencial financeiro.
Outro ponto relevante é que ambas as formações permitem seguir caminhos acadêmicos, empreender no setor tecnológico ou atuar como consultor especializado. Ou seja, são carreiras com grande flexibilidade e múltiplas possibilidades de crescimento.
Como escolher as graduações?
A decisão entre os dois cursos deve considerar principalmente o seu perfil, interesses e objetivos profissionais. Não existe uma escolha universalmente melhor, mas sim aquela que faz mais sentido para o seu projeto de vida.
Se você gosta de eletrônica, sistemas físicos, robótica e deseja atuar em projetos que envolvem infraestrutura tecnológica, o course Computer Engineering pode ser a opção mais alinhada.
Já se o seu interesse está em programação, desenvolvimento de aplicativos, inteligência artificial ou análise de dados, a ciência da computação tende a ser mais adequada.
Também é importante avaliar a grade curricular, as oportunidades de estágio em Engenharia da Computação, o networking e a reputação da instituição de ensino. Esses fatores podem influenciar diretamente a sua empregabilidade e o desenvolvimento das competências necessárias para se destacar no mercado.
Tecnologia é o futuro — e a escolha certa acelera sua carreira
Tanto a Computer Engineering quanto a Ciência da Computação são formações estratégicas em um mundo cada vez mais digital. A diferença está no tipo de atuação que você deseja ter e nos desafios que mais despertam sua motivação profissional.
Ao compreender as particularidades de cada curso, você consegue tomar uma decisão mais consciente e alinhada às oportunidades do mercado. Investir em uma graduação de qualidade, desenvolver habilidades práticas e acompanhar as tendências tecnológicas são passos essenciais para construir uma carreira sólida e promissora.
Se você está pronto para dar o próximo passo rumo ao futuro profissional na área de tecnologia, conheça as opções de cursos e escolha uma instituição que ofereça estrutura, professores qualificados e conexão real com o mercado.